WebJan 8, 2024 · Radial tunnel syndrome. If you have pain on top of your forearm when gripping, then radial tunnel syndrome could be a potential cause. This injury occurs when the radial nerve at the elbow becomes compressed or pinched. It often results from overuse of the forearms, particularly due to excessive gripping, bending of the wrist, or pinching. WebLinda J. Alongside hand weakness, other symptoms ... WebBefore using the pincer grasp, baby grabs with their whole hand. They may do a “raking” grasp around 6 months, which is where they bring their fingers to their palm to pick up small items like bits of food. As they get older, they may use a movement that looks like the pincer grasp, but uses the pads of the thumb rather than the top of the ...
WebAug 14, 2024 · by Joana Carvalho, PhD August 14, 2024. Scientists have created a new type of split-hand index — which identifies the loss of the pincer grasp — that is able to distinguish people with am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S) from healthy individuals at the earliest stages of the disease. WebJan 18, 2024 · Hands and Fingers in Parkinson's Disease. If no interventions are put in place to remedy the situation, the hands of people with PD become stiffer, with fingers more curled up and eventually the ability to pick things up, grasp or push and pull is lost.
